It starts with you.As the Financial Performance Manager/Finance Business Partner, you’ll collaborate with senior leadership teams to drive the financial performance of our hospitals and achieve our ambitious 2026 EBITDA goals. You’ll bring expertise in delivering financial improvements, ideally within private hospitals, to this vital role.Your responsibilities will include:Monitoring growth plans to ensure initiatives stay on track or are effectively mitigated if notIdentifying efficiency opportunities and challenging costs to optimise our charity resourcesEmbedding a culture of continuous financial performance improvementProviding commercial decision support and business insightsAppraising business performance and investment opportunitiesManaging stakeholders across site leadership teams, regional management, and the Executive CommitteeSupporting central initiatives on an ad-hoc basis, as neededTo succeed as our Financial Performance Manager / Finance Business Partner, you’ll bring:ACA or equivalent accountancy qualification with post-qualification experienceProven track record of driving financial improvement within a complex organisationStrong stakeholder management skills with the ability to challenge and negotiate effectivelyExperience in FP&A or finance business partneringExceptional communication, influencing, and analytical skillsHigh commercial acumen and the ability to identify actionable insightsExperience in the healthcare industry, particularly within private hospitals, and across multiple sites is advantageousHelping you feel good.We want you to love coming to work, feeling healthy, happy and valued.
